Risk of damage to the environment! ● Make sure to follow all instructions described in this manual. Busch standing filter is placed upstream of the vacuum pump and protect it from damage caused by process contaminants such as liquids or solids.

5 | Storage Storage ● Seal hermetically all apertures with the caps provided with the machine, or with adhesive tape if the caps are no longer available. ● Store the separator indoors, in a dry place, away from dust and vibrations and if possible, in original packaging, preferably at temperatures between 5 ...
● Make sure that the installation conditions are fully respected. The standing filter is intended for the filtering of air and other dry, non-aggressive, non-toxic, and non-explosive gases. In events with aggressive substances in process, please contact your BUSCH representative.

In case of long connection lines: ● Use larger diameters to avoid a loss of efficiency. ● Contact your Busch representative for more information. ● Connect the condensate drain to the wastewater or eliminate them in compliance with applicable regulations in case of contamination by the process.

Loss of efficiency! ● Any dismantling of the separator that goes beyond anything that is described in this manual should be done by Busch authorized technicians. ● Make sure of a regular draining of the standing filter. ● Make sure that during the maintenance work, on all in- and outputs of the standing filter atmo- spheric pressure is applied.
